MR. MARTIN LEE: Sir, does the Administration accept that the relatively small number of complaints about unsafe toys may be just the tip of the iceberg because many potential hazards associated with toys are not appreciated by parents and because many parents simply throw away dangerous toys without making a complaint?
FINANCIAL SECRETARY: Yes, Sir, we are aware of what Mr. Martin LEE has said and we accept that we probably are dealing with the tip of the iceberg. Again, that is exactly why the working group was established, and that is exactly why we are proposing to introduce legislation into this Council. We would not be proposing to introduce legislation into this Council if there were only just a very few number of cases.

MRS. LAU: Sir, as a follow-up on my previous question, can the Administration inform this Council why it will not encourage the relevant manufacturer or importer to withdraw the product from the market instead of seeking to introduce legislation?
FINANCIAL SECRETARY: Sir, we certainly would not mind telling manufacturers that facts had been drawn to our attention. But it would be very difficult for us to compel manufacturers to withdraw products from the market until we have the necessary legislative powers. Nevertheless, I take note of what Mrs. LAU has said.
